Still Time to Enroll in Late-Start Yoga Class

The fall 2003 semester has been under way at College of the Canyons for a month and a half, but that doesn’t mean you can’t enroll in some classes that get a later start.

A late-start yoga class is a good example. Starting Oct. 6 and running through Dec. 15, a yoga class that meets from 5 to 7:20 p.m. and again on Saturday from 1 to 3:20 p.m. still has plenty of openings.

The class is an introduction to the physical practices of yoga, including breathing techniques, poses, postures and stretching exercises to promote flexibility. This is a 1-unit, for-credit class available through the COC Dance Department.

An estimated 20 million Americans participate in yoga classes across the country, and many pay inflated rates for the privilege. At College of the Canyons, the enrollment fee is only $18 per unit.
